Leverage On Long Tail Keywords In Market Research

There are actually many approaches to earn a living on the internet. However no matter which route you choose, it all begins with market analysis. You have to locate a group of customers who have a typical difficulty or need. Then all you need to do is sell them information that solve the difficulty or fulfill the need.

Market research can be separated into two segments - discovering a profitable niche and finding long tail search terms within that niche. The nice thing is that there are quite a few zero cost tools available to do this. Some of the best resources are provided by Google itself. And so the first thing to do is subscribe for an account with Google. After you have done that, visit Google's search-based keyword tool at www.Google.com/sktool. Type in the words 'buy, purchase, order, get' (without quote marks) into the search field. The sktool will list out 800 phrases or terms which include these buying key phrases together with other useful data such as level of competition, queries per month and so on. All you need to do is choose the term that you feel is most suitable for yourself, if possible one that has not less than 2,500 searches every month.

After that, click on the icon that looks like a magnifying glass next to the search term that you have chosen. This will take you to Google Insights for Search, yet another free resource from Google at www.Google.com/insights. It will rapidly lookup the term that you have chosen and produce the relevant info at Google insights. Scroll down to the bottom area of the page and you will notice additional similar search terms. Take note of all the related search terms that you find.

At this point you would have got around 10 buying keyword terms in a specific market. This basically suggests that there are people seeking information to remedy a problem or meet a need within this niche. After that, you will need to investigate further into how big a market this niche is and find more search term ideas.

Go to amazon.com, ebay.com, magazines.com and clickbank.com. Insert the major keyword of the niche into the search field and see if there are products that are mentioned in these websites within this particular niche. It's likely that you will locate products in just about all these websites pertaining to your niche. Briefly review some of the products for tips - both keyword ideas and product or service ideas. The next stage is to uncover long tail keywords.

To do this, head to Google's external keyword tool at https://adwords.Google.com/select/KeywordToolExternal. Type in your 10 keywords and it will crank out a list of connected keywords. Take note of the keyword phrases with a minimum of 3 words in them (long tail keywords) and also that produce at least 2,500 searches per month.

Then go to the Google search engine at www.Google.com and enter in the main keyword within quote marks. As you are typing, Google will give you related search terms. Take note of the long tail keywords. When you hit the search button, Google will list out all of the websites relevant to your search phrase (this is called the SERP or Search Engine Results Page). Take note of the number of websites listed (it is listed at the top right hand part of the page). You are aiming for keywords having a maximum of 1,000,000 websites. When it is substantially bigger than 1 million, then the keyword is too competitive. Do the same thing with every one of the keywords that you have and pick out all those that have got less than 1 million competing websites.

For each of the keywords you type into Google, check out the bottom of the SERP and you will find extra suggested related keywords. Simply click on them and you can get even more keywords. Drill down into the keywords as deeply as you can until eventually you find long tail keywords with lower than 1 million competing websites.

Assuming you have completed your market research good enough, you will now have identified a niche with ready customers and the long tail keywords (approximately 10 will work) that they use in order to search in the search engine for information on a product to shop for.
